Isaiah 15:5

KJV

My heart shall cry out for Moab; his fugitives shall flee unto Zoar, an heifer of three years old: for by the mounting up of Luhith with weeping shall they go it up; for in the way of Horonaim they shall raise up a cry of destruction.

— Isaiah 15:5, King James Version

Context

This verse from Isaiah Chapter 15 connects to 10 cross-references. A brief oracle against Moab describing mourning in Ar and Kir, with refugees fleeing and waters running red with blood. The chapter lists various Moabite cities whose inhabitants are in lamentation. The desolation will be complete.
